Raising Royalty: Setting Up for Miniature Highland Calves
Preparing to begin with raising miniature highland calves is a pleasurable journey that requires careful planning. These adorable calves are known for their gentle temperament and unique appearance.
A well-structured shelter is essential to ensure their well-being. The paddock should be sufficiently sized View more to allow for exploration. Offering clean, fresh water and a balanced feed is crucial for their development.
To build a healthy environment, consider incorporating different combinations of bedding materials such as straw, wood shavings, or hay. This will help in maintaining warmth and absorbing moisture. Regular cleaning is also essential to avoid the transmission of illnesses.
Moreover, ensure entry to a sheltered area to protect them from extreme temperatures.
Top-Tier Mini Highland Calf Home Setup
Welcoming a mini Highland calf into your life is a truly rewarding experience. To ensure their well-being, it's crucial to create a welcoming home setup that caters to their individual needs. Firstly, you'll want to assemble a sturdy shelter that provides shelter from the sun and rain. A well-insulated shed is ideal, with plenty of space for them to graze.
- Guarantee a clean bedding area using hay, and always change it fresh for optimal comfort.
- Offer access to drinkable water at all hours. A heated water source is particularly beneficial in harsh climates.
- Boost their diet with a nutritious mix of grass, and consider supplementing with grain for extra growth.
Always bear in mind that mini Highland calves are gregarious, so ensuring companionship with additional calves or a friendly adult is highly advantageous. With a some effort and care, you can create the perfect environment for your mini Highland calf to thrive!
